Are you a good boss...or a bad boss?

Would your employees---if given the choice---ever want to work for you again?

Most important of all, are you in tune with what it feels like to work for you?

Dr. Robert Sutton wrote Good Boss, Bad Boss to answer these questions, inspired by the thousands of e-mails, articles, blog posts, and conversations provoked by his bestseller The No Asshole Rule. Dr. Sutton now applies his commonsense approach to show how the great bosses in our world differ from those who are just so-so, or, worse yet, downright inept.

If you are the boss, are you a good one? How can you keep honing your skills---and stir your people to give their all and be proud to work for you? Are you in tune with how your words and deeds (and those little looks on your face) affect your followers? What do they really think of you---are you aware of how they see you, or do you live in a fool's paradise? If they had a choice, would they continue to work for you?

Sutton weaves together real-life case studies and pertinent behavioral science research to deliver a precise and sometimes startling account of what the best bosses do.

Good Boss, Bad Boss delivers a definitive manifesto for anyone who has ever been elevated to a position of authority---and a blueprint of salvation for those who suffer because their bosses just don't seem to get it.
